Lt. Reginald Reynolds, the combat systems officer aboard the Coast Guard Cutter Stratton (WMSL 752) discusses the mock-boarding training with members of a law enforcement team from the USS Montgomery after the team ran through a drill aboard the Stratton during Cooperation Afloat Readiness and Training (CARAT) Indonesia, Aug. 6, 2019. CARAT, the U.S. Navy's longest running regional exercise in South and Southeast Asia, strengthens partnerships between regional navies and enhances maritime security cooperation throughout the Indo-Pacific.
